Understanding Your Rewards Activity
Last updated February 28, 2026
The Rewards Balance page gives you a full picture of how your rewards are performing. Beyond just your current balance, you can track the value of your rewards over time, see how they're being distributed, and review your funding history.
Rewards Value Chart
This chart tracks the value of your rewards balance over time. Because rewards are denominated in sats (Bitcoin), their dollar value fluctuates with the Bitcoin price.

Rewards Distribution Chart
This chart shows the status of all rewards distributed from your account, filterable by month. Rewards fall into three categories:
- Claimed — The customer received the rewards notification and clicked the "Claim Rewards" button. This is effectively their opt-in to your rewards program. Once claimed, all future rewards from purchases are also automatically claimed.
- Pending — The rewards have been distributed and the customer has received a notification, but they haven't claimed them yet. Pending rewards are still within the 30-day claim window.
- Recycled — The customer did not claim their rewards within 30 days. These sats are automatically returned to your rewards balance, replenishing your funds.
Rewards Invoices
The invoices table shows every funding transaction on your account. Each entry includes:
- Payment method — Whether you paid with Bitcoin or dollars
- Transaction type — Manual load or auto recharge
- Date and sats received
- Reference ID — For dollar payments, this links to your Stripe invoice
Use this to track your funding history and reconcile your rewards spend.
